SMF6.0A/SMF6.0CA Overview

TVS diodes SMF6.0A/SMF6.0CA, SOD-123 package, peak pulse power 200W, are used in overvoltage protection of sensitive electronic parts, covering automotive electronics, consumer electronics, industrial equipment, household appliances, communication equipment and other fields.

SMF Series
Working Voltage: 5.0 to 350 V
Peak Pulse Power: 200 W
Features
Surface Mount
Transient Voltage Suppressors
SOD-123
Glass passivated chip
200 W peak pulse power capability with a
10/1000 μs waveform, repetitive rate (duty
cycle):0.01 %
Low leakage
Uni and Bidirectional unit
Excellent clamping capability
Very fast response time
RoHS compliant
Case: Molded plastic
Epoxy: UL 94V-0 rate flame retardant
Lead: Solderable per MIL-STD-750, method
2026
Polarity: Color band denotes cathode end
except Bipolar
Mounting position: Any
